Subversion Repository Public Repository

litesoft

Diff Revisions 949 vs 950 for /trunk/Java/GWT/OldClient/src/org/litesoft/GWT/eventbus/client/nonpublic/ChannelServiceResult.java

Diff revisions: vs.
  @@ -1,53 +1,53 @@
1 - // This Source Code is in the Public Domain per: http://unlicense.org
2 - package org.litesoft.GWT.eventbus.client.nonpublic;
3 -
4 - import java.io.*;
5 -
6 - public class ChannelServiceResult implements Serializable {
7 - enum State {Normal, Serverlost, ForceClose}
8 -
9 - private int mMessageSequenceNumber;
10 - private State mState;
11 - private ChannelServicePackage mPackage;
12 -
13 - /**
14 - * @deprecated GWT ONLY
15 - */
16 - public ChannelServiceResult() {
17 - }
18 -
19 - private ChannelServiceResult( int pMessageSequenceNumber, State pState,
20 - ChannelServicePackage pPackage ) {
21 - mMessageSequenceNumber = pMessageSequenceNumber;
22 - mState = pState;
23 - mPackage = pPackage;
24 - }
25 -
26 - public static ChannelServiceResult forceClose( int pMessageSequenceNumber ) {
27 - return new ChannelServiceResult( pMessageSequenceNumber, State.ForceClose, null );
28 - }
29 -
30 - public static ChannelServiceResult serverLost( int pMessageSequenceNumber ) {
31 - return new ChannelServiceResult( pMessageSequenceNumber, State.Serverlost, null );
32 - }
33 -
34 - public static ChannelServiceResult normal( int pMessageSequenceNumber, ChannelServicePackage pPackage ) {
35 - return new ChannelServiceResult( pMessageSequenceNumber, State.Normal, pPackage );
36 - }
37 -
38 - public int getMessageSequenceNumber() {
39 - return mMessageSequenceNumber;
40 - }
41 -
42 - public boolean isForceClose() {
43 - return State.ForceClose.equals( mState );
44 - }
45 -
46 - public boolean isServerLost() {
47 - return State.Serverlost.equals( mState );
48 - }
49 -
50 - public ChannelServicePackage getPackage() {
51 - return mPackage;
52 - }
53 - }
1 + // This Source Code is in the Public Domain per: http://unlicense.org
2 + package org.litesoft.GWT.eventbus.client.nonpublic;
3 +
4 + import java.io.*;
5 +
6 + public class ChannelServiceResult implements Serializable {
7 + enum State {Normal, Serverlost, ForceClose}
8 +
9 + private int mMessageSequenceNumber;
10 + private State mState;
11 + private ChannelServicePackage mPackage;
12 +
13 + /**
14 + * @deprecated GWT ONLY
15 + */
16 + public ChannelServiceResult() {
17 + }
18 +
19 + private ChannelServiceResult( int pMessageSequenceNumber, State pState,
20 + ChannelServicePackage pPackage ) {
21 + mMessageSequenceNumber = pMessageSequenceNumber;
22 + mState = pState;
23 + mPackage = pPackage;
24 + }
25 +
26 + public static ChannelServiceResult forceClose( int pMessageSequenceNumber ) {
27 + return new ChannelServiceResult( pMessageSequenceNumber, State.ForceClose, null );
28 + }
29 +
30 + public static ChannelServiceResult serverLost( int pMessageSequenceNumber ) {
31 + return new ChannelServiceResult( pMessageSequenceNumber, State.Serverlost, null );
32 + }
33 +
34 + public static ChannelServiceResult normal( int pMessageSequenceNumber, ChannelServicePackage pPackage ) {
35 + return new ChannelServiceResult( pMessageSequenceNumber, State.Normal, pPackage );
36 + }
37 +
38 + public int getMessageSequenceNumber() {
39 + return mMessageSequenceNumber;
40 + }
41 +
42 + public boolean isForceClose() {
43 + return State.ForceClose.equals( mState );
44 + }
45 +
46 + public boolean isServerLost() {
47 + return State.Serverlost.equals( mState );
48 + }
49 +
50 + public ChannelServicePackage getPackage() {
51 + return mPackage;
52 + }
53 + }